On the other hand, fuel-injected engines offer improved efficiency, precision in fuel delivery, and better monitoring capabilities via Exhaust Gas Temperature (EGT) probes.
These features contribute to longer engine life and better overall performance. However, fuel-injected engines tend to be more complex, requiring additional components like electric fuel pumps and potentially needing hot start procedures.
In summary, carbureted engines are typically preferred for their simplicity and cost effectiveness, whereas fuel-injected engines are favored for their reliability, efficiency, and advanced monitoring capabilities.
